Harold “Hal” Dessau passed away peacefully at home on Monday, Aug. 24, 2020 in Huntsville, AL. He was born in Toronto Canada on Apr 23,1936 and grew up with his younger sister Gail (Stocker) in the LA area. He had a loving marriage to Ruth Schimmel Dessau for 59 years, who passed away this past December. Together they had three children – Lori (deceased), Daniel (living in Boulder, CO with his wife Kathy), and Debra (living in Huntsville) and two grandchildren (Michael and Jessica).
He was an electrical engineer, graduating with a bachelor’s degree from Caltech and PhD from Yale, moving to the Huntsville area in the mid-80’s with Ruth and daughter Debra. Besides his engineering skills, Hal had many talents and interests and was widely read, including writing some of his own stories and poems. Together with Ruth he enjoyed classical and Israeli music, natural foods, organic gardening, and caring for their special-needs daughter Debra. They all greatly enjoyed the loving and supportive environment here in Huntsville, and he very much enjoyed taking his grandkids around Huntsville when they visited.
Hal suffered a debilitating stroke in 2014, and was blessed by the tremendous love, care, and help he received from so many people since that time. He will be greatly missed, and always remembered.
